Beaded Ladder Strap for Sandals

The Beaded Ladder Strap for Sandals is an intermediate beading project that perfectly blends beauty with functionality, offering a stylish way to embellish footwear while challenging the beader to work with structural strength and flexible design. Using ladder stitch as the primary construction technique, the project demands consistent tension, durable threadwork, and careful attention to spacing to ensure that the beadwork both decorates and reinforces the sandal straps. The finished straps are not only decorative but also strong enough to handle the movement and wear that sandals endure during daily use.

Choosing the right materials is critical to the success of the project. High-quality seed beads such as Miyuki Delicas or Toho rounds are essential for their consistency, which ensures that the ladder stitch remains straight and even. Size 8/0 or 6/0 beads are ideal for this type of application, as they are large enough to provide visibility and strength without overwhelming the design. A durable, abrasion-resistant beading thread like FireLine is necessary because the straps will be subjected to friction and stress. Using a heavy-duty beading needle, such as a size 10 or 12, is recommended for easy passage through thicker beads and multiple thread passes.

The construction of the beaded ladder strap begins by anchoring two parallel threads or cords, which serve as the vertical rails of the ladder. The beader stitches one bead at a time between these rails, threading first through one side, then through the bead, and finally through the opposite side to create the rung. Tension is crucial; each bead must sit snugly without causing the rails to pucker or the structure to become too rigid. Working methodically, the beader builds a flat, flexible strap that mirrors the width and length required to replace or overlay the original sandal strap.

Design considerations are central to making the ladder strap both attractive and wearable. Simple solid color designs emphasize the clean, architectural beauty of the ladder stitch itself, while more intricate patterns can be created by varying bead colors along the strap. Stripes, geometric motifs, or even tribal-inspired patterns can be easily integrated by planning the color sequence in advance. Using contrasting finishes such as matte, metallic, and transparent beads together adds visual depth and sparkle, especially when the sandals catch the light in motion.

To attach the finished beaded ladder strap to the sandal, the ends must be securely fastened. If replacing an existing strap, the beaded piece can be sewn directly into the sandal’s footbed or looped through existing eyelets or anchor points. Reinforcing the attachment with multiple thread passes and possibly backing the ends with leather or sturdy fabric ensures long-term durability. If overlaying an existing strap, strong adhesive can be used to affix the beaded ladder to the strap’s surface, although additional stitching through the edges may provide a more secure and flexible hold.

An important aspect of the design is ensuring that the strap retains enough flexibility to move naturally with the foot while maintaining its decorative appearance. Ladder stitch, being a flat and somewhat flexible weave, accommodates this requirement well, but the beader must be careful not to overtighten the structure during construction. Test-fitting the strap periodically during the beading process can help ensure a perfect fit and appropriate drape over the sandal.

Additional embellishments can elevate the design further. Fringe elements at the sides of the straps, small charms, or tiny crystal accents can be added for extra flair. However, care must be taken that embellishments do not cause discomfort or interfere with the function of the sandal. A balance must be maintained between decorative richness and wearability, particularly because the straps will flex and rub against the skin during use.
